Me, Flycastin, and another guy got to our area around 7:00 and started the nasty hike up the mountain. Once on top I spotted a few elk and then more and then even more. We estimated about 200-300 head of elk up there with a bunch of bulls still packing antler. We decided to let them move on and then go search the area for early shedders. We immediately found two nice browns, a five point and a six point. We had not even got to the area the elk were in and had already found some nice sheds.
We continued on hoping to find a bunch more sheds, but only found one more old rag horn. Once we started down the mountain we picked up a few deer antlers and called it a day. All together we found 4 elk and 3 deer in 7 miles of hiking. Once again, I did all the research and my friends find all the antlers. Oh well, maybe next time. [crazy]
